Mutation detailsAn exchange vector was designed to be inserted downstream of exon 1 of the gene using dual-recombinase mediated cassette exchange (dRMCE). Specifically, the exchange vector contained (from 5 to 3) an FRT site, a viral F2A oligopeptide (to mediate ribosomal skipping), an enhanced green fluorescent protein sequence, a viral T2A oligopeptide, and a Cre-ERT2 sequence (Cre recombinase fused to a G525R mutant form of the mouse estrogen receptor ligand-binding domain). A rox-flanked puromycin resistance cassette and a loxP site were inserted at the 3' end of the exchange vector. (J:159099)

The exchange vector (along with the pDIRE plasmid containing an icre-expression cassette and a Flpo-expression cassette to facilitate insertion of the exchange vector) was electroporated into C57BL/6N-derived JM8A1.N3 knockout first reporter embryonic stem (ES) cells obtained from the Knockout Mouse Project (KOMP) consortium containing clone EPD0314_2_A09. Recombined ES cells lack the neo cassette and are resistant to puromycin.
